70% to passThe signal man assisting the crane operator first taps his elbow with one hand and then proceeds to use regular signals. This is the signal to _______________.
A
use the main hoist
B
proceed slowly
C
increase speed
D
use the whip line
AI Explanation
The correct answer is D) use the whip line. The tap on the elbow with one hand is a signal to the crane operator to use the whip line (a smaller, secondary line) instead of the main hoist. This is a standard hand signal used in crane operations to indicate a change in the equipment being used. The other answer choices do not correctly match this specific hand signal.
